#72130C Hex Color Code

#72130C

The Hexadecimal Color #72130C is a contrast shade of Maroon. #72130C RGB value is rgb(114, 19, 12). RGB Color Model of #72130C consists of 44% red, 7% green and 4% blue. HSL color Mode of #72130C has 4°(degrees) Hue, 81% Saturation and 25% Lightness. #72130C color has an wavelength of 617.48148n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#72130C is #993333.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#72130C is #711. The Closest Color to #72130C is #800000. Official Name of #72130C Hex Code is Cedar Wood Finish.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#72130C is 0 Cyan 83 Magenta 89 Yellow 55 Black and #72130C CMY is 0, 83, 89.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#72130C is hsl(4,81,25,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(4, 89, 45).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#72130C is 7.24, 4.07, 0.75.
Hex8 Value of #72130C is #72130CFF. Decimal Value of #72130C is 7475980 and Octal Value of #72130C is 34411414. Binary Value of #72130C is 1110010, 10011, 1100 and Android of #72130C is 4285666060 / 0xff72130c.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#72130C is 0.6, 0.337, 0.337 and YIQ Color Space of #72130C is 46.607, 58.8596, 17.9141.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#72130C is 6.93, 1.82, 0.81.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#72130C is 23.9, 39.96, 30.48.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#72130C is 23.9, 66.09, 15.82.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#72130C is 23.9, 50.26, 37.34. Hunter Lab variable of #72130C is 20.17, 28.75, 11.92.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#72130C

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
